如何建立ip核
作者:路由通
|
69人看过
发布时间:2026-03-26 13:48:00
标签:
在当今高度集成的半导体领域,知识产权核已成为构建复杂芯片的基石。本文旨在系统性地阐述建立一套完整、可靠且可复用的知识产权核的方法论。内容将涵盖从市场分析与规格定义,到具体的设计实现、验证、封装及文档管理的全流程,并结合行业最佳实践与权威标准,为工程师和设计团队提供一份具备深度和专业性的实战指南,助力提升设计效率与产品质量。
在数字世界的底层,每一块功能强大的芯片内部,都运行着无数精密的逻辑单元。这些单元,如同建筑中的预制构件,可以被设计、验证并重复用于不同的项目之中,它们被称为知识产权核。无论是处理复杂运算的中央处理器核心,还是管理数据吞吐的接口单元,其高效开发与可靠集成,都离不开一套严谨的建立流程。对于希望提升研发效率、确保芯片一次成功的团队而言,掌握建立知识产权核的系统方法,是从容应对市场竞争的关键能力。本文将深入探讨这一过程,为您揭示从无到有构建一个高质量知识产权核的完整路径。
一、确立明确的目标与市场定位 任何成功产品的起点都源于清晰的目标。在着手设计第一个晶体管之前,必须回答几个根本问题:这个知识产权核要解决什么具体问题?它的目标应用场景是移动设备、数据中心,还是汽车电子?预期的性能、功耗和面积目标是什么?更重要的是,它在市场中与现有方案相比有何独特价值?深入的市场调研和竞品分析不可或缺。参考行业分析机构如全球半导体贸易统计组织的报告,有助于理解技术趋势与市场需求。明确的目标如同航海图,确保后续所有设计决策都不会偏离航向。 二、制定详尽的功能规格说明书 目标明确后,需要将其转化为工程师可以执行的技术语言,这就是功能规格说明书。这份文档是知识产权核的“宪法”,它必须毫无歧义地定义核的所有外部行为、接口信号、寄存器配置、工作模式以及性能指标。例如,对于一个图像处理核,规格书需要明确规定其支持的图像格式、分辨率、处理算法精度和吞吐率。制定过程应遵循诸如电气电子工程师学会标准等权威框架,确保严谨性。一份优秀的规格书不仅能指导设计,更是后续验证与用户集成的唯一依据,应经过多方评审并冻结版本。 三、进行前瞻性的架构设计与折衷 有了规格书,下一步是勾勒出实现它的蓝图,即架构设计。这一阶段需要决定知识产权核的内部组织方式:是采用流水线结构提升吞吐量,还是用状态机控制流程?存储单元如何组织?数据通路如何设计?关键在于进行多方面的折衷分析。高性能往往意味着高功耗和面积,而低功耗设计可能限制最高工作频率。利用高级建模语言如系统C进行架构级仿真,可以在投入大量精力进行寄存器传输级设计之前,快速评估不同架构的性能与功耗表现,从而做出最优选择。 四、完成寄存器传输级设计与编码 架构确定后,便进入具体的寄存器传输级设计阶段。设计者使用硬件描述语言,将架构转化为精确的、可综合的电路描述。编码风格至关重要,它直接影响到电路的综合质量、可测试性和可读性。应遵循业界公认的编码指南,例如同步设计原则、使用明确的复位策略、避免生成锁存器等。代码需要模块化、参数化,以便于配置和重用。同时,需要考虑设计是否易于进行静态时序分析以及后续的物理实现。整洁、规范的代码是高质量知识产权核的基石。 五、构建多层次的功能验证环境 验证是确保设计符合规格的关键,其工作量通常远超设计本身。必须建立一个系统化、自动化的验证环境。这通常包括编写大量的测试用例,以覆盖正常功能、边界情况、错误注入等所有场景。采用受约束的随机测试方法可以高效地探索巨大的状态空间。断言检查可以嵌入在设计中,用于实时监测特定协议或属性的违反。参考通用验证方法学等验证方法学,有助于构建可重用、可扩展的验证平台。目标是通过充分的验证,达到极高的功能覆盖率。 六、执行彻底的静态时序分析与约束 功能正确不代表电路能在实际硅片中正常工作。静态时序分析是评估电路在特定工艺、电压和温度条件下能否满足时序要求的核心手段。这需要设计者编写准确的时序约束文件,为工具定义时钟、输入输出延迟、时序例外等。约束的完整性和准确性直接决定了分析结果的可信度。必须在设计的早期阶段就开始定义和验证约束,并在整个流程中不断迭代更新。忽略静态时序分析,很可能导致芯片在流片后出现时序违例而无法工作。 七、实施综合与可测性设计插入 将寄存器传输级代码转化为门级网表的过程称为逻辑综合。综合工具根据设计约束和指定的工艺库,对电路进行优化。综合后需要评估面积、时序和功耗是否达标。与此同时,必须考虑芯片的可测试性。为了在生产后能够高效检测制造缺陷,需要在设计中插入可测性设计结构,最常见的是扫描链。这允许测试仪将内部寄存器连接成移位寄存器,从而控制和观察芯片内部状态。可测性设计插入需要精心规划,以平衡测试覆盖率与面积、性能的开销。 八、完成形式验证与等价性检查 在经历了综合、布局布线等优化步骤后,必须确保优化后的网表在功能上与原始寄存器传输级设计完全一致。这时就需要进行形式验证,特别是等价性检查。形式验证工具使用数学方法,穷尽地证明两个设计在逻辑上是等价的,它不依赖于测试向量,因此可以达到百分之百的覆盖率。在综合后、插入可测性设计后、以及布局布线后的每个关键节点,执行等价性检查是防止功能在优化过程中被意外修改的必备安全网。 九、集成物理设计考量与原型分析 即使是数字知识产权核,也不能完全脱离物理现实。在设计的早期阶段,就应对其物理特性进行预估和分析,即原型分析。这包括使用物理信息模型对核的尺寸、形状、引脚位置进行规划,并估算其布线拥塞、功耗分布和热特性。与后端物理设计团队保持密切沟通,理解目标工艺的规则与限制,将有助于设计出更易于布局布线的前端结构。一个具有良好物理设计友好性的知识产权核,能显著降低系统级芯片集成的难度和风险。 十、建立完备的交付物封装标准 一个知识产权核的价值在于其能被顺利地集成到更大的系统中。因此,必须将其所有相关文件按照标准格式进行封装。交付物通常被称为“知识产权核交付包”,其内容应有严格定义,至少包括:综合后的门级网表、完整的时序约束文件、用于集成的抽象模型、验证测试套件、以及各种格式的仿真模型。许多公司遵循业界标准如知识产权核联盟的标准来组织交付包,以确保不同来源的知识产权核能够被设计工具顺畅读取和使用。 十一、编写清晰详尽的技术文档 文档是知识产权核与用户之间的桥梁。没有高质量的文档,再优秀的设计也难以被正确使用。技术文档体系应至少包含:集成手册,详细说明接口信号、配置寄存器、时钟与复位方案;用户指南,解释核的功能、编程模型和软件接口;验证手册,描述验证环境的使用方法;发布说明,记录版本变更信息。文档的编写应站在用户的角度,力求清晰、准确、示例丰富。它是降低集成成本、减少支持工时的关键资产。 十二、实施严格的版本控制与配置管理 在整个开发周期中,设计代码、约束文件、测试平台和文档会产生无数个版本。严格的版本控制与配置管理是维持项目秩序、支持团队协作、以及实现可追溯性的基础。应使用专业的版本控制系统对所有文件进行管理,建立清晰的分支策略,例如区分开发分支、发布分支和维护分支。每一次重要的修改都应有明确的提交日志。配置管理则确保在构建某个特定版本的知识产权核交付包时,能够精确地组合相应版本的所有组件,避免组件版本不匹配带来的混乱。 十三、规划长期维护与客户支持策略 知识产权核的交付不是终点,而是长期合作的起点。必须预先规划好维护与支持策略。这包括设立渠道收集和跟踪用户反馈与问题报告,制定清晰的错误修复和功能增强流程,以及规划定期的版本更新。对于共性的问题或使用技巧,可以整理成知识库或应用笔记分享给所有用户。良好的支持不仅能解决用户当下的困难,更能积累口碑,为知识产权核的持续改进和后续产品的开发提供宝贵输入。 十四、考量知识产权保护与授权模式 作为“知识产权”核,其核心价值在于其中蕴含的独创性设计思想。因此,知识产权保护至关重要。这通常涉及申请专利以保护关键算法和架构创新。同时,需要制定合理的授权模式,明确用户购买后获得的权利,例如使用权、修改权、再授权权等。授权协议应经过法律专业人士的审核,在保护自身商业利益与满足客户灵活性需求之间取得平衡。清晰的知识产权策略是进行商业交易和技术合作的前提。 十五、融入系统级芯片协同设计流程 一个孤立的知识产权核价值有限,其最终使命是作为系统级芯片的一部分发挥作用。因此,建立流程必须考虑与系统级芯片整体设计流程的协同。这包括提供准确的功耗、性能和面积模型,供系统架构师进行早期评估;确保核的接口协议与芯片总线架构兼容;提供符合芯片级验证要求的模型和断言。积极参与到系统级芯片的规划中,理解其整体目标与约束,能使知识产权核的设计更具针对性和集成友好性。 十六、遵循行业标准与接口协议 可重用性的一个重要方面是兼容性。设计知识产权核时,应尽可能遵循成熟的行业标准与接口协议。例如,片上互联采用高级微控制器总线架构或开放核心协议,存储器接口采用双倍数据速率同步动态随机存储器标准,数据接口采用通用串行总线或外围组件互连高速标准。遵循标准不仅减少了用户集成的适配工作,也意味着核可以接入一个庞大的生态系统,与来自其他供应商的标准组件无缝协作,极大提升了其应用范围和价值。 十七、利用自动化工具提升效率与质量 建立知识产权核的流程涉及大量重复性和规则性的任务,非常适合通过自动化来提升效率、减少人为错误。这包括使用脚本自动生成寄存器传输级代码框架、验证测试模板、文档片段;建立自动化的回归测试流程,每晚自动运行完整测试套件并生成报告;构建持续集成环境,在每次代码提交后自动进行综合、静态时序分析和等价性检查。投资于流程自动化,能将工程师从繁琐的事务中解放出来,专注于更有创造性的设计工作,同时保障交付物质量的一致性。 十八、构建持续学习与改进的文化 最后,但同样重要的是,建立高质量知识产权核的能力并非一蹴而就,它依赖于团队持续的学习与改进。在每个项目结束后,应进行复盘,总结成功经验与教训。鼓励工程师研究最新的设计方法学、工具和工艺技术。参与行业会议、技术论坛,与同行交流实践。将积累的经验固化到设计规范、检查清单和流程模板中。这种持续改进的文化,能够确保团队的方法论始终与时俱进,从而在快速变化的半导体行业中保持竞争力,源源不断地创造出卓越的知识产权核产品。 综上所述,建立知识产权核是一项融合了技术创新、工程管理和商业智慧的综合性活动。它远不止是编写代码,而是一个始于市场、终于交付与支持的完整生命周期。从明确目标到最终维护,每一个环节都环环相扣,共同决定了核的质量、可用性和市场成功。遵循系统化的方法,注重每一个细节,积极拥抱行业最佳实践,方能在激烈的技术竞争中,打造出真正坚实、可靠且富有价值的芯片设计基石。
相关文章
提到“coto什么品牌”,许多人会感到陌生。实际上,它并非一个独立的消费品牌,而是一个源自日本、专注于社区商业与社交电商的创新平台。本文将深入剖析其发展脉络、核心商业模式、独特功能以及在全球市场,特别是在东南亚地区的影响。通过解读其如何连接线下邻里与线上社群,我们能够理解这一模式对现代零售业与社区关系的重塑。
2026-03-26 13:47:43
75人看过
在当今复杂多变的社会环境中,“保护”与“被保护”构成了维系系统稳定与个体安全的核心关系网络。本文将从法律、科技、生态、文化、经济等十二个维度,深度剖析不同领域中“什么保护什么”的互动机制与内在逻辑,揭示那些无形却至关重要的防护屏障如何运作,并探讨其对于构建安全、可持续未来的深远意义。
2026-03-26 13:46:18
385人看过
技术日渐是一个描述技术持续发展、日益精进和广泛渗透的动态过程。它并非单一事件,而是指技术在性能、效率、应用广度和对社会影响的深度上,随着时间的推移而不断增强和深化的总体趋势。这一过程体现在硬件迭代、软件算法革新、跨领域融合以及技术对生产生活方式的根本性重塑之中,是驱动现代社会演进的核心力量。
2026-03-26 13:46:16
390人看过
模拟摄像头,即模拟信号摄像头,是一种通过同轴电缆传输连续模拟视频信号的摄像设备。其核心在于将光学图像转换为连续变化的电信号进行传输与记录。本文将从技术原理、系统构成、历史沿革、核心优势与局限、典型应用场景、与网络摄像头的对比、安装调试要点、未来演进方向等十余个维度,为您深度解析这一经典安防技术的内涵与外延。
2026-03-26 13:45:52
95人看过
在众多电视尺寸中,32英寸网络电视凭借其适中的尺寸和亲民的价格,成为小户型家庭、卧室或厨房的理想选择。其价格跨度从数百元到两千余元不等,主要受品牌定位、屏幕面板技术、硬件配置以及智能系统功能等因素综合影响。本文将深入剖析影响价格的各个维度,并提供选购时的核心考量点,助您在预算内找到最适合自己的那一款网络电视。
2026-03-26 13:45:51
277人看过
在电子表格软件中,单元格角落的感叹号图标是许多用户既熟悉又困惑的存在。它并非简单的装饰,而是软件内置诊断与辅助功能的核心视觉标识。本文将深入解析感叹号出现的十二种核心场景,涵盖数据验证警告、公式错误检查、智能填充提示、安全警告及辅助功能通知等。通过结合官方文档与实用案例,系统阐述其触发机制与处理策略,帮助用户从被动忽略转向主动利用,从而提升数据处理的准确性与工作效率。
2026-03-26 13:45:41
226人看过
热门推荐
资讯中心:
.webp)
.webp)
.webp)
.webp)
.webp)
.webp)